Output 805942acafb9ecc51612528cee237c41ebfbceb75479cdc2869f064ae5b5cf0a:0

value
172590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ea8a1504e66f260f3eb18800df54c05bb8d2f986 OP_EQUAL
address
3P59TYZcboUHc5BcEFYF8qhFGLsnnGGrGm
transaction
805942acafb9ecc51612528cee237c41ebfbceb75479cdc2869f064ae5b5cf0a
spent
true